大断面隧道支撑拆除与二衬施工影响分析  被引量:10

Influence Analysis of Support Demolition and Secondary Lining Construction for Large Cross-section Tunnel

在线阅读下载全文

作  者:李凌宜[1] 

机构地区:[1]北京市公路桥梁建设集团有限公司,北京100068

出  处:《施工技术》2013年第17期38-40,共3页Construction Technology

摘  要:在隧道二衬施工时,常规做法均为拆除1段临时支撑,施工1段二衬,此做法安全性较高,但施工场地有限,影响施工进度。采用专业有限元软件MIDAS/GTS和现场监测,对长沙地铁某区间大断面暗挖隧道的临时支撑拆除与二衬施工时机相互间的影响进行了分析及现场实施,得出可以采取先行拆除2个施工段的所有临时支撑,然后再隔段随拆撑随二衬施工,既可以节省施工时间,也可以保证施工安全。The regular method of secondary lining is secondary lining construction after temporary supports demolition of one construction section, which can ensure safety, but effect construction progress. Using finite element software MIDAS/GTS and field monitoring, the author analyzes influence of temporary supports demolition and secondary lining construction in large cross-section metro tunnel in Changsha to obtain the method of firstly secondary lining construction after all temporary supports demolition of two construction section and secondary lining construction at the first section and temporary supports demolition at the three section, which can save time and ensure construction safety.
